JOB SUMMARY: We are looking for an experienced welder with specialized knowledge in stainless steel welding to join our team. As a Stainless Steel welder, you will be responsible for fabricating, installing, and repairing stainless steel equipment and systems, ensuring compliance with industry standards.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ITES:
• Welding and Fabrication: Perform TIG and MIG welding on stainless steel materials for food processing machinery, conveyors, tanks, and pipes. Ensure all welds meet the required strength and quality standards.
• System Installation and Repair: Install and repair stainless steel equipment, including food processing machinery, storage tanks, pipelines, and HVAC systems, ensuring they are fully operational and meet sanitation standards.
• Hygiene Compliance: Ensure that all stainless steel welds and installations are carried out in compliance with food safety and sanitation regulations (e.g., FDA, USDA, GMP). Maintain a high level of cleanliness and sanitation in welding and fabrication areas.
• Inspection and Quality Control: Inspect welded joints and fabricated parts for defects, cleanliness, and compliance with company and regulatory standards. Perform tests on welds and systems to ensure their durability and integrity.
• Maintenance Support: Assist in the maintenance of food processing equipment by repairing or replacing worn or damaged stainless steel parts to minimize downtime and improve operational efficiency.
• Safety Compliance: Adhere to all safety protocols, including using personal protective equipment (PPE) and safe work practices. Follow all OSHA guidelines and food safety standards to ensure a safe and compliant working environment.
• Tool and Equipment Care: Maintain and repair welding tools, equipment, and machinery, ensuring they are in good working condition. Report any malfunctions or safety hazards promptly.
• Other duties as assigned.
